This specific model year relies on a precise oil filter specification to ensure optimal engine lubrication and protection against wear. Replacing this component with every oil change—typically every 5,000 to 7,500 miles—prevents these particles from circulating and scoring the cylinder walls and bearings, which can lead to costly engine repairs down the line.
